#79c49d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#79c49d is composed of 47.5% red, 76.9%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.9%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 148.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 62.2%. #79c49d color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#00893b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#79c49d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#79c49d has RGB values of R:121, G:196,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 7980189.

Shades and Tints of #79c49d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f4fa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#79c49d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9f9e is the less saturated color, while #45f89b is the most saturated one.
